    Status: Tampa Bay Lightning center

    HT: 6-foot-4 WT: 223 pounds

    DOB: April 21, 1980 In: Ile Bizard, Que.

    Hockey Inspiration: "Steve Yzerman."



    Hobbies/Leisure Activities:
    "Golf, watching movies, boating."



    Nickname:
    "Just Vinny."



    Favorite Movie:
    "Blackhawk Down."



    Favorite TV Show:
    "24."



    Musical Tastes:
    "U2, Metallica."



    Early Hockey Memory:
    "Christmas one year I got a pair of Easton gloves (blue and white). It was like the happiest Christmas. I slept with them (age 11)."



    First Job:
    "I was a...how do I explain it...I took care of a handicapped kid during day camp. He was the only handicapped kid there and I took care of him (age 13)."



    First Car:
    "Cavalier Z24 (red)."



    Pre-game Feeling:
    "Think about being relaxed, but don't get too excited – until I get on the ice. That's when you get intense."



    Favorite Meal
    : "Sushi."



    Favorite Ice Cream Flavor:
    "Chocolate."



    Greatest Sports Moment:
    "Winning the Stanley Cup (2004)."



    Favorite Uniforms:
    "I like the Los Angeles Kings and New York Rangers."



    Favorite Arena:
    "Montreal."



    Closest NHL Friends:
    "Brad Richards, Dan Cloutier."



    Funniest Player Encountered:
    "Andre Roy. He's just crazy, funny. He’s got a great sense of humor."



    Toughest Competitor Encountered:
    "Wendel Clark. I played with him in '98. (Why him?) He's just...you've heard of him, you saw how he played. The look he has. Just tough."



    Worst Injury
    : "Broken foot. Getting hit by a shot. (Remember who shot it?) (Dan) McGillis from Philadelphia."



    Funny Hockey Memory
    : "Just watching Andre Roy every day. No special story. I don't know how he does it. He's just funny. (Was he your roommate?) I lived with him for one week. After one day I was like, ‘Wow, how can his wife handle that?’ "



    Embarrassing Hockey Memory:
    "A few years ago I went on the ice in Buffalo. I ran out to the ice pretty hard and I didn't see the red carpet they had out at center ice. I hit the carpet and spun around, ran into the boards, lost my helmet, gloves, stick, everything. That was pretty embarrassing. And my sister was watching."



    Favorite Vacation Spot:
    "I liked South Africa the best – Capetown."



    Favorite Athletes To Watch:
    "Cristiano Ronaldo, he's just exciting. He's got that little arrogance that's funny. Just unbelievable to watch. (MLB?) Derek Jeter. Complete player, just like his style. (NFL?) Peyton Manning. (Golf/Tennis?) Tiger, Roger Federer. (Boxing?) I always liked (Mike) Tyson. (NASCAR?) The only one I know is Jeff Gordon.”



    Personality Quality Most Admired
    : "Loyalty."
